        고실 사구종과 혼동되었던 침샘 분리종 1예

        임종현,김무건,김인식,박철원 대한이비인후과학회 2015 대한이비인후과학회지 두경부외과학 Vol.58 No.11

        Salivary gland choristoma is defined as the architecturally normal salivary gland tissues found in abnormal locations. Middle ear salivary gland choristoma usually presents with conductive hearing loss. We present a case of middle ear mass with conductive hearing loss in a 6-year-old boy. A reddish mass was incidentally found behind the normal tympanic membrane. Magnetic resonance image showed the markedly enhancing lesion which was in accordance with glomus tympanicum. Preoperative angiography was performed, but supplying artery and mass was not identified. Surgical exploration was made and the mass was dissected easily without profuse bleeding. Final diagnosis was salivary gland choristoma by histopathology. We discuss the clinical features and management of middle ear salivary choristoma with the review of literature.

        2010년~2021년 국내 메타버스와 가상세계를 활용한 교육 연구 동향 분석: LDA 기반 토픽 모델링과 시계열 회귀분석을 적용하여

        임종현,홍진표,박정민,안미리 한국교육정보미디어학회 2022 교육정보미디어연구 Vol.28 No.2

        Using LDA-based Topic Modeling and Time-Series Regression Analysis, this study analyzed educational research trends in domestic virtual environments (Metaverse, Virtual Worlds, and VR) and presented educational implications. The abstracts of 418 domestic academic papers (340 academic papers and 78-degree papers) were collected and analyzed in the Metaverse and Virtual Environment field between 2010 and 2021. LDA-based Topic Modeling Analysis extracted six topics: ‘Social Change and Educational Use in Cultural and Language Education,’ ‘Rehabilitation Training Treatment,’ ‘Disabled Students Intervention/Vocational Education,’ ‘Higher Education Practice Simulation,’ ‘Safety Education Training,’ and ‘School Class Application.’ The Time-Series Regression Analysis with the LDA Topic Modeling Analysis result revealed that all topics were statistically significant and appeared to be hot topics. As a result of the study, future research should consider instructional design, teaching and learning methods, and empirical research examining the essential aspects of the learning process for educational use of the virtual environment in response to social changes. Furthermore, it is necessary to research the learning process in a game-based Metaverse environment such as Roblox and Minecraft, where learners can freely create and change objects. It is expected that the results of this study will be used as primary data in research and related fields on education using virtual environments, including metaverse, in the future. 본 연구는 LDA 기반 토픽 모델링과 시계열 회귀분석을 적용하여 메타버스와 가상세계를 중심으로 국내 가상환경 활용 교육 연구 동향을 분석하여, 교육공학적 시사점을 제시하였다. 분석 데이터로 2010년 ~ 2021년 동안의 메타버스 및 가상세계를 활용한 교육 관련 국내 학술 논문 418편(학술지 논문 340편, 학위논문 78편)의 초록을 수집하여 분석하였다. LDA 기반 토픽 모델링 분석을 통해 ‘사회적 변화 및 문화․언어교육 활용’, ‘재활훈련치료’, ‘장애학생 중재/직업교육’, ‘고등교육실습 시뮬레이션’, ‘안전교육훈련’, ‘학교 수업 적용’으로 6개의 토픽을 추출하였다. LDA 토픽 모델링 분석 결과를 근거로 시계열 회귀분석을 실시하여 토픽별 추세를 파악하였다. 모든 토픽이 Hot 토픽으로 나타났고, ‘사회적 변화 및 문화․언어교육 활용’ 토픽이 가장 큰 증가 추세를 보였으며, 그 다음으로 ‘안전교육훈련’, ‘학교 수업 적용’ 등의 순으로 나타났다. 연구 결과, 가상환경 활용 교육 연구가 2017년부터 상당한 증가의 경향을 보이다가 2021년에 급격히 증가하였다. 향후 연구는 사회적 변화에 부응하는 가상환경 활용 교육을 위한 교수설계, 교수․학습 방법, 학습 과정의 본질적인 면을 살펴보는 실증적 연구 등의 방향성을 제안한다. 또한 학습 과정에서 학습자가 자유롭게 객체를 생성․변경할 수 있는 로블록스나 마인크래프트와 같은 게임 기반 메타버스 환경에서의 학습활동에 대한 연구 등이 필요하다. 본 연구의 결과가 향후 메타버스를 비롯한 가상환경 활용 교육에 대한 연구 및 관련 분야에 기초자료로 이용되기를 기대한다.

        인후두 역류증 환자에서 Reza Band 사용의 안전성 및 효과: 예비연구

        임종현,유병준,이동원,송창면,지용배,태경 대한이비인후과학회 2018 대한이비인후과학회지 두경부외과학 Vol.61 No.8

        Background and Objectives The main treatment of laryngopharyngeal reflux disease(LPRD) includes life style modification and proton pump inhibitor (PPI) medication. However,LPRD is sometimes refractory to PPI medication. The Reza band has been developed toexert external pressure on the upper esophageal sphincter thus preventing gastric acid refluxto the larynx and pharynx. The aim of this study was to evaluate safety and efficacy of usingthe Reza band in patients with LPRD. Subjects and Methods We prospectively enrolled 16 LPRD patients who were refractoryto PPI medication and who had agreed to wear the Reza band. Patients were treated with theReza band and PPI medication simultaneously or only the Reza band. We studied complicationsrelated to the Reza band, analyzed Reflux Symptom Index (RSI) and Reflux Finding Score(RFS) before and after the application of the band up to 12 weeks. Results The Reza band was endured by 15 patients except one patient. One patient (6.25%)ceased wearing the band due to pain and discomfort in the neck. No major complications occurred,except one patient who reported mild neck discomfort when the band was applied. The mean value of RSI before the application of the Reza band was 12.31±6.43, which significantlyimproved at 8 weeks and 12 weeks (9.17±5.08, p=0.005 and 8.20±5.59, p=0.007, respectively)post-treatment. The mean value of RFS before the application of the Reza band was13.50±2.97, which significantly improved at 2, 4, 8, and 12 weeks (p<0.05) post-treatment. Conclusion We conclude that the Reza band is safe and effective for the treatment of LPRDin properly selected patients.

        자발성 소뇌출혈의 치료방법과 예후

        임종현,윤일규,도재원,배학근,이경석,이인수 대한신경외과학회 1990 Journal of Korean neurosurgical society Vol.19 No.3

        We analysed a series of 35 patients with primary cerebellar hemorrhage, diagnosed by computerized tomography scanning from 1985 to 1988. They constituted 6.6% of spontaneous intracerebral hemorrhages (35 out of 530) who were admitted during the same period. There were 13 men and 22 women. The site of hemorrhage was vermis in 15 patients and hemisphere in 20 patients. On admission, the Glasgow Coma Scale(GCS) value was less than 10 in 15 patients(42.3%) and not less than 10 in 20 patients(57.1%). Quadrigerminal cistern was normal in 11 patients(31.4%), partially obliterated in 15 patients(42.9%), and completely obliterated in 9 patients(25.7%). The largest diameter of the hematoma was less than 3cm in 15 patients(42.9%) and larger than 3cm in 20 patients( 57.2%). Hydrocephalic change was observed in 21 patients( 60%). The hematoma was removed via suboccipital craniectomy in 16 patients(45.7%) and managed conservatively in II patients(31.4%). In 8 patients(22.9%), external ventricular drainage was performed. The method of treatment was different according to the GCS value on admission, the status of the quadrigeminal cistern, the presence of hydrocephalic change, and the size of hematoma. Overall mortality rate was 22.9%. These results suggested that the conservative treatment can be done in patients with (1) high GCS value(not less than 10), (2) patent quadrigeminal cistern, (3) absent hydrocephalic change, and (4) small sized hematoma(less than 3cm). If not, surgical treatment should be considered.

      • Theoretical Approach to Investigate Photocatalytic Acitivity of TiO<sub>2</sub> Nanoparticles

        임종현,남연식,이진용 한국공업화학회 2019 한국공업화학회 연구논문 초록집 Vol.2019 No.1

        TiO<sub>2</sub> has been highlighted as eco-friendly energy source due to its photocatalytic activity. However wide band gap of TiO<sub>2</sub> lower photocatalytic performance. There have been a lot of efforts to enhance the activity by modifications such as nanostructuring, oxygen defects, chemical doping. Investigating effects of these modifications on light absorption and charge recombination by experimental method is limited due to inevitable presence of defect and ununiformed particles. In order to overcome this limit, theoretical approaches are needed. The density functional theory (DFT) methods and modeling for analyzing TiO<sub>2</sub> nanoparticles are discussed. Furthermore, chemical modification strategies such as band engineering by controlling structure of TiO<sub>2</sub> nanoparticles and introducing oxygen defects or chemical doping are also discussed. Finally, theoretical studies on excited state dynamics involving charge carrier separation, diffusion, and recombination are discussed.

        Electrical properties of metal-ferroelectric-insulator-semiconductor structure with Lanthanum Dysprosium Oxide and SrBi_2Ta_2O_9

        임종현,Kwi-Jung Kim,Gui-Zhe An,박병은 한국물리학회 2011 THE JOURNAL OF THE KOREAN PHYSICAL SOCIETY Vol.59 No.31

        The metal-ferroelectric-insulator-semiconductor (MFIS) structure using SrBi_2Ta_2O_9 (SBT) film as a ferroelectric layer and lanthanum dysprosium oxide (LDO) film as an insulating buffer layer was prepared. The LDO thin film and SBT film were deposited by sol-gel method. The sol-gel derived LDO thin films on Si had very flat and smooth surface morphologies. The equivalent oxide thickness (EOT) values were about 10.1 nm, 12.5 nm, and 12.8 nm for 750 ˚C, 800 ˚C, and 850 ˚C, respectively. Also, the relative dielectric constant of 750 °C-annealed, 800 °C-annealed and 850 °C-annealed LDO films were about 15.4, 12.5, and 12.2, respectively. On the whole, the leakage current densities showed the good characteristics regardless of the annealing temperature variations. Especially, the leakage current property of the 850 °C-annealed LDO film was visibly superior to the others over 6V. The C-V characteristics of Au/SBT/LDO/Si structure showed clockwise hysteresis loops, and the memory window width increased as the bias voltage increased. Also, the leakage current density was lower than 5 ×10^(-7) A/cm^2

      • 느타리버섯의 갓색 관련 laccase의 발현에 관한 연구

        임종현,송민진,김경윤,손은숙,조영섭,조중호,이창수 한국버섯학회 2007 버섯 Vol.11 No.1

        Laccase는 균류와 식물에서 광범위하게 알려진 효소로서 다양한 기질에 대하여 촉매반응을 나타낸다. 오래 전부터 펄프산업에서 리그닌의 제거와 섬유소의 표백작업, 그리고 오염 된 물과 토양의 복원 등의 여러 응용성에서 잠재적인 산업적 효소로서 주목을 받고 있다. 현재는 버섯의 자실체로부터 세포내 효소의 작용에 대한 연구가 시작되었으며, 최근에는 표고버섯의 자실체에서 laccase가 melanin의 생합성에 중요한 역할을 하고 있음이 보고된 바 있다. 이에 우리는 일정한 조건에서 특정한 색의 갓을 보이는 느타리버섯에서 흑색 및 갈색을 나타내는 색소인 melanin과의 연관성을 laccase의 효소활성으로 확인고자 하였다. 시료는 느타리버섯에서 분리한 흑색 및 백색의 갓 색 변이체를 사용하였으며, 생활 주기와 자실체의 부위별로 나누어 각각 효소활성을 측정하여 비교하였다. 버섯시료를 sodium phosphate 완충액에서 homogenizing한 후 원심분리하여, 그 상등액을 조효소액으로 사용하였다. Laccase 활성은 McIlvaine 완충액상에서 2,2'-azino-bis(3-ethylbenthiazoline-6-sulfonic acid) diammonium salt (ABTS)를 기질로 사용하여 효소와 반응시켰으며, ABTS의 산화에 의해 생성된 산화물을 ELISA를 통해서 측정하였다. 그 결과, laccase 효소활성은 갓 색 변이체(흑, 백색)의 자실체 중에서 흑색 자실체가 가장 높았으며, 생활주기별(균사체, 원기, 자실체, 포자)에서는 균사체가 가장 높았다. 또한, 느타리버섯의 자실체 부위별(갓, 갓껍질, 갓주름, 줄기)에서는 갓 껍질이 가장 높은 것으로 확인되었다.
